Understanding Your Rolex and its Strap Requirements:

Before embarking on your strap replacement journey, knowing your Rolex model is paramount. Different models utilize different lug widths (the distance between the watch case lugs where the strap attaches), buckle types, and overall design aesthetics. Incorrectly identifying your lug width can lead to a poorly fitting strap, potentially damaging your watch or causing discomfort.

Your first step should be to determine your Rolex's lug width. This measurement is typically expressed in millimeters (mm). You can find this information in your Rolex documentation, on the Rolex website (by searching your specific model), or by carefully measuring the distance between the lugs with a ruler. Common lug widths for Rolex watches include 18mm, 19mm, 20mm, and 21mm, but others exist depending on the model. Be precise with this measurement; even a 1mm difference can prevent a proper fit.

Next, consider the type of strap or bracelet your Rolex currently uses. This will influence your replacement options. Popular choices include:

* Oyster bracelets: These iconic metal bracelets are synonymous with Rolex and are known for their robust construction and durability. Replacement Oyster bracelets are typically sourced directly from Rolex or authorized dealers. They offer a classic, sporty look and are highly resistant to wear and tear.

* Leather straps: Offering a more refined and versatile aesthetic, leather straps provide a sophisticated alternative to metal bracelets. Leather straps come in various colours, textures, and finishes, allowing for greater personalization. Genuine Rolex leather straps are available, but high-quality aftermarket options provide a wider range of choices at varying price points.

* Rubber straps: Increasingly popular, rubber straps offer durability, comfort, and a sporty, modern look. These are particularly well-suited for water activities or for those seeking a more casual feel. Like leather straps, both genuine and aftermarket rubber options exist.

* NATO straps: Known for their durability and quick-release functionality, NATO straps are a popular aftermarket choice for Rolex watches. They offer a more casual, military-inspired aesthetic and are easily interchangeable.

Genuine Rolex Watch Straps UK & Globally:

For those seeking the ultimate authenticity and quality, genuine Rolex straps are the preferred option. These straps are crafted to the same exacting standards as the watches themselves, ensuring a perfect fit and long-lasting durability. However, genuine Rolex straps command a premium price, and availability can be limited.

Purchasing genuine Rolex straps requires careful consideration. Authorized Rolex dealers are the safest bet, guaranteeing authenticity and providing warranty support. Be wary of unofficial sellers or online marketplaces, as counterfeit straps are unfortunately prevalent. Always verify the seller's credentials and examine the strap carefully for any signs of inconsistencies before purchasing.
